I've got an issue with one machine here that's having searches redirected.
You search for whatever you want on whatever search engine you want but when
you click on the result, you get redirected to a different site. Even if I
block that particular site in the Vipre console, the next time it redirects
to *another* site. I can get to the correct website if I manually enter that
address in the address bar, but clicking on a search link results in a
redirect. It happens on ALL browsers.

Neither Vipre Enterprise nor MBAM find anything, but *something* is
redirecting the search results. Any ideas? I've got a ticket in with
Sunbelt, and they've escalated it to the security team, but I thought I'd
see if anyone here has any ideas while I wait for the Sunbelt Security team
to call me back.

Possibly related, possibly not. The machine in question has Google Chrome
and if Javascript is enabled I can go to Google and start entering a search,
and it'll lock up Chrome after the first couple characters. If I disable
Javascript on www.google.com it lets me go ahead and search.

O/S is Windows XP Pro SP3. Vipre agent and definitions are up-to-date. The
hardware is relatively powerful desktop... don't know for sure what it is
and I can't get to it right now from remote to check, but it's pretty
responsive.
